REFREALAZIHTI - REAL AZImuthal REFL/transm coeff for HTI media refRealAziHTI [optional parameters] >coeff.data Optional parameters: vp1=2 p-wave velocity medium 1 (with respect to symm.axes) vs1=1 s-wave velocity medium 1 (with respect to symm.axes) eps1=0 epsilon medium1 delta1=0 delta medium 1 gamma1=0 gamma medium 1 rho1=2.7 density medium 1 vp2=2 p-wave velocity medium 2 (with respect to symm.axes) vs2=1 s-wave velocity medium 2 (with respect to symm.axes) eps2=0 epsilon medium 2 delta2=0 delta medium 2 gamma2=0 gamma medium 2 rho2=2.7 density medium 2 modei=0 incident mode is qP =1 incident mode is qSV =2 incident mode is SP modet=0 scattered mode rort=1 reflection(1) or transmission (0) azimuth=0 azimuth with respect to x1-axis (clockwise) fangle=0 first incidence angle langle=45 last incidence angle dangle=1 angle increment iscale=0 default: angle in degrees =1 angle-axis in rad =2 axis horizontal slowness =3 sin^2 of incidence angle ibin=1 binary output =0 Ascci output outparfile =outpar parameter file for plotting coeffile =coeff.data coefficient-output file test=1 activate testing routines in code info=0 output intermediate results Notes: Axes of symmetry have to coincide in both media. This code computes all 6 REAL reflection/transmissions coefficients on the fly. However, the set-up is such Real reflection/transmission coefficients in HTI-media with coinciding symmetry axes. However, the set-up is such that currently only one coefficient is dumped into the output. This is easily changed. The solution of the scattering problem is obtained numerically and involves the Gaussian elimination of a 6X6 matrix. ", AUTHOR:: Andreas Rueger, Colorado School of Mines, 02/10/95 original name of code <graebnerTIH.c> modified, extended version of this code <refTIH3D> Technical references: Sebastian Geoltrain: Asymptotic solutions to direct and inverse scattering in anisotropic elastic media; CWP 082. Graebner, M.; Geophysics, Vol 57, No 11: Plane-wave reflection and transmission coefficients for a transversely isotropic solid. Cerveny, V., 1972, Seismic rays and ray intensities in inhomogeneous anisotropic media: Geophys. J. R. astr. Soc., 29, 1-13. .. and some derivations by Andreas Rueger. If propagation is perpendicular or parallel to the symmetry axis, the solution is analytic (see graebner2D.c and rtRealIso.c
